About this home

Beautifully cared-for corner unit in Otay Ranch. Light and bright floor plan with 2 beds, 2.5 baths, attached 2 car garage plus extra assigned parking space. Laminate flooring, recessed lightning, and a kitchen with granite counters and brand-new stainless appliances. In -unit fire sprinkler system for enhanced safety. The front door leads to a patio balcony. Spacious closets in every bedroom. Trash covered by HOA. Quiet, walkable location to: restaurants, shops, dining, parks, transit, and top rated schools plus community amenities. Move in ready!.
